There is a huge range of Career ideas available for individuals interested in sciences and mathematics. Some New careers, which have started life as a result of improving technology, and some older, more established Careers which have been around for many, many years. Many of the Careers have a direct effect on various aspects of people’s lives. There are Careers offered within health and medicine, testing new drugs to help treat illnesses and ailments, and also testing new methods of treatment which is safer and less invasive than current methods. New careers are also open within the food and drink sector, researching and creating new foods suitable for consumption. It’s probably not going to influence people’s lives the way making new medicines might, however it’s still a very important job. Then there is a big range of Careers that use mathematics and problem solving, in a huge variety of sectors, including but not limited to engineering, meteorology, financial services, electronics. Just about every industry needs a mathematician at some point.
So as you can see, there are a wealth of Career ideas available to pick from that use science and maths to great lengths. As the Careers are immensely diverse, so are the working environments that you could find yourself in – from working in a normal office doing Monday to Friday, to operating in the field doing research, to handling dangerous substances within a laboratory environment. Employers will also vary a lot, you could be working for the government, working for a massive multi-national corporation, or working from the comfort of your own home. There are countless possibilities available for the committed person who is determined to do well and accomplish something.
Entry to the majority of the job areas mentioned do require that you are educated to degree level, and also have some work experience, which is normally received doing part-time help or work where possible, or by undertaking a work placement in your preferred sector. Pay for fully skilled individuals is normally very good, and increases quite a lot as you advance through your career. Development through career paths is normally on individual merit, working up to supervisory and then management positions, so for individuals who are willing to commit themselves to performing as well as possible, they can expect extremely good career expansion opportunities.
